A proxy is an intermediary server with its own IP address. Your traffic exits through that address instead of yours, so websites see the proxy's location and identity, the basis for privacy, geo-testing and large-scale data collection.

A residential proxy routes your traffic through a real household IP assigned by a consumer ISP. Websites treat it as an ordinary local visitor, which keeps success rates high. LemonClub sources these lines ethically, with device-owner consent.
